Bagduma Population - Uttar Dinajpur, West Bengal

Bagduma is a medium size village located in Itahar Block of Uttar Dinajpur district, West Bengal with total 234 families residing. The Bagduma village has population of 1209 of which 608 are males while 601 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Bagduma village population of children with age 0-6 is 170 which makes up 14.06 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Bagduma village is 988 which is higher than West Bengal state average of 950. Child Sex Ratio for the Bagduma as per census is 910, lower than West Bengal average of 956.

Bagduma village has lower literacy rate compared to West Bengal. In 2011, literacy rate of Bagduma village was 62.37 % compared to 76.26 % of West Bengal. In Bagduma Male literacy stands at 61.08 % while female literacy rate was 63.65 %.

Caste Factor

There is no population of Schedule Caste (SC) and Schedule Tribe(ST) in Bagduma village of Uttar Dinajpur district.

Work Profile

In Bagduma village out of total population, 424 were engaged in work activities. 60.38 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 39.62 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 424 workers engaged in Main Work, 186 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 58 were Agricultural labourer.
